Recent forecasts from meteorological sources indicate a likely maximum of 36–37°C for Jeddah on September 1 under persistent northwest winds, clear skies, and Red Sea humidity levels near 50%, aligning with early-September climatology where average highs reach 36–38°C. Model consensus shows stable high pressure suppressing cloud cover and precipitation, though minor variations in peak timing, wind gusts, or localized urban heat effects could shift the daily maximum by 1–2°C. With outcomes clustered tightly around 37–39°C, traders appear to weigh short-term ensemble uncertainty and historical extremes above the baseline forecast, favoring slightly warmer readings consistent with typical late-summer variability.

The resolution source for this market will be information from NOAA, specifically the highest reading under the "Temp" column for all times on this day, available here: https://www.weather.gov/wrh/timeseries?site=oejn
If NOAA data for the observation date is unavailable by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, the Weather Underground Daily Observations table will be used as the resolution source.
To toggle between Fahrenheit and Celsius, click the "Switch to Metric Units" button until the relevant table displays °C.
This market can not resolve until the first data point for the following date has been published on the resolution source.
The resolution source for this market measures temperatures to whole degrees Celsius (eg, 9°C). Thus, this is the level of precision that will be used when resolving the market.
Revisions to temperatures recorded within this market's timeframe will be considered until the first datapoint for the following date has been published, after which any alterations will not be considered.
